I have a problem assigning a value to a global variable and using it inside of a function. Here is my code:
var chartinfo = {"c0":"0", "c1":"0"}; // This is my global variable
$.getJSON("http://127.0.0.1:8080/chartinfo", function(json1){
chartinfo = json1; // I need to assign json1's value to chartinfo
});
$(function () {
$(document).ready(function() {
alert("external chartinfo " + chartinfo.c0.name); // I need to use chartinfo here

The alert fails because your request is not finished yet. You could try this:
var chartinfo = {
"c0": "0",
"c1": "0"
};
var jqxhr = $.getJSON("http://127.0.0.1:8080/chartinfo", function (json1) {
console.log("success");
})
.done(function () {
chartinfo = json1;
alert("external chartinfo " + chartinfo.c0.name); // I need to use chartinfo here
})
.fail(function () {
console.log("error");
})
